A software that allows users to add HTML searches to their website, enabling visitors to quickly search through the site's content.
The software supports content queries that use Boolean and regular expressions, as well as phrase and proximity searches, fuzzy and partial word searches, and similarity search. With optional spell checking on queries, it provides a "Did you mean?" functionality similar to Google. Additionally, Boolean Search can extract various kinds of summaries, icons, meta tag information, and standard file attributes, providing an expansive variety of file information for the search results page.
One novel feature of Boolean Search is its "Site Index" generator, which serves up a linked index of all the words a site contains. The software can also generate documents with search terms highlighted to help users determine their relevancy, and paging and sorting mechanisms are available to manage browsing the collection of found files.
Some key features of Boolean Search include its fast, ram-based index, browser-based administration, configurable server root that can be set to any folder, directory-based iteration that is ideal for unlinked document collections, and support for multiple websites (multi-homing). It also offers a monitor window and logging, server realms for access restrictions, fully customizable search forms and results pages, stop words and synonyms, proximity and phrase searches, linked document word highlighting via HTML anchors, regular expressions, Boolean logic and wildcards. Additionally, HTML formatting of the "word index" provides access to all words on your website, and various query methods such as exact, partial, and approximate searches on file attributes such as size or modification date.
